The foundation of Paul Teutul Jr.'s wealth is undeniably rooted in the success of Orange County Choppers (OCC). What started as a small family-owned motorcycle shop in Newburgh, New York, exploded into a global brand thanks to the Discovery Channel series that aired from 2002 to 010. The show provided a raw, unfiltered look at the world of custom bike building, showcasing Paul Jr.'s intense work ethic, temperamental nature, and undeniable talent for design. This exposure was the rocket fuel needed for exponential growth. The bikes themselveselaborate, chrome-plated masterpieces often selling for tens of thousands of dollarsbecame rolling advertisements. However, the real revenue stream came from the merchandise and licensing deals that followed the show's popularity. From replica models to branded apparel, OCC moved beyond just building bikes to selling the "Orange County Choppers" lifestyle, a venture that significantly padded Paul Jr.'s net worth.

The foundation of 600breezy net worth is built upon the pillars of YouTube and Twitch. He first garnered attention through his raw and unfiltered commentary on gaming and life, quickly distinguishing himself with a brash, energetic, and often controversial style. This approach, while not for everyone, cultivated a fiercely loyal fanbase that appreciates his unvarnished perspective. The revenue generated from these platforms is multifaceted, stemming from advertisements, channel memberships, and super chats. However, to attribute his wealth solely to these sources would be a gross oversimplification. True to his brand, 600breezy has diversified his income streams, moving beyond the digital ether into the world of physical merchandise. By offering his fans clothing and accessories adorned with his signature branding, he has not only created another revenue channel but also strengthened the sense of community and identity among his supporters. This synergy between online persona and offline product is a hallmark of his business acumen.

To understand the current standing of Mae Whitman net worth, one must first look back at the foundational years that established her presence in Hollywood. She began her career as a toddler, appearing in commercials and making her television debut in 1995 on the series *The Girl Next Door*. This early exposure was followed by a steady stream of guest appearances on popular television shows throughout the late 1990s, including *ER*, *The Practice*, and *Judging Amy*. These initial roles were crucial, serving as her apprenticeship in the industry, allowing her to hone her craft in front of the camera. Yet, it was her breakthrough role as Ann Veal on the critically acclaimed Fox sitcom *Arrested Development* (2004-2005, 2013-2019) that truly changed her trajectory. Playing the insecure and sexually repressed younger sister to Jason Bateman's Michael Bluth, Whitman delivered a performance that was both heartbreaking and hilarious. The show, despite its initial cancellation, gained a massive cult following through syndication and word-of-mouth, embedding "Ann Veal" into the pop culture lexicon. This role provided the financial springboard necessary to negotiate future projects, significantly impacting the upper echelons of what would become her net worth.
